tarior I installed my valley oil line last night, but not heeding MC's advice to leave the beer alone until after the job is done, I drilled a 13/64" pilot hole perfectly into the oil galley.....right between the #1 and #3 lifter bores #-o #-o #-o CRAP!! Fortunately, I own a TIG machine and I welded it up today, I used Welco #65 nickel rod with the flux sanded off and a 2% thoriated tungsten. I preheated the immediate area around the weld to about 250 degees, welded it up and peened it. I think it will be OK... :oops:
